【 摘 要 】
In order to detect the possible collision of steel structural in virtual pre-assembly environment, a collision detection program based on the bounding box algorithm and the spatial triangle intersection detection algorithm was developed. And the feasibility and effectiveness of the collision detection program in virtual pre-assembly were verified by an example. The results showed that: according to this method, the collision detection in virtual pre-assembly has good feasibility and is suitable to practical projects.
